Intensive outpatient treatment, or "IOP", is a method of rehabilitation for an addiction problem that is significantly more comprehensive and involved than a standard outpatient program. Intensive outpatient treatment is fundamental action for clients in Baskett who have recently finished inpatient or residential rehabilitation, and still need moderate assistance and encouragement while they progress to a clean and sober and wholesome lifestyle. IOP's involve therapy which occurs much more frequently than standard outpatient, where clients will take part in treatment services and activities on a part time basis unless otherwise determined.
Intensive outpatient treatment normally involves individual and group counseling sessions to continue to treat the person's addiction. Individual sessions often take place at least once a week, and group sessions can provide the peer support that is essential for long term recovery. While in intensive outpatient treatment, clients work on building relapse prevention skills, managing every day challenges and triggers, and how to manage any discomforts and drug cravings. Some intensive outpatient treatment programs incorporate family and couples/marriage counseling into the treatment process, which can be essential for people who must repair their lives with their families and loved ones.
